Vesta is unusual as it contains what mineral on its surface? What does the presence of this material indicate?

Explanation: Vesta is second largest object in the asteroid belt after dwarf planet Ceres. Basalt which is found on Vesta which is very unusual to be found on an asteroid. Its presence indicate the volcanic activity at some point in Vesta's distant past. Basalt is a fine-grained igneous rock. It is formed when bits of lava shoot out of volcanoes.

A 4kg watermelon is dropped from a height of 45m. What is the velocity of the watermelon just before it hits the ground?
Makovka662 [10]

Answer:

v=30 m/s

Explanation:

h - height

g - acceleration due to gravity=10

t - time

v- velocity

h =  \frac{1}{2}  \times g \times t {}^{2}

45 = 5t²

t² = 9

t=3 seconds

v=g×t

v=10×3

v=30 m/s
